@@relentless302, I had the same issues you describe since I started solid food on July 3rd (throwing up, stomach pain, having trouble knowing when to stop eating) and yesterdary I went back on liquid diet for a few days. My doctor's and my conclusion is that it was too soon for me to go on solid foods. It is an incredibly difficult balancing act to get enough Fluid and Protein. I haven't met those marks in a while. But I'm doing better now that I'm back on the liquid Proteins. I think we just have to do the best we can. If you keep having trouble tolerating food, you might want to talk to your doctor about going back on Liquid Protein for a while. Its a bit depressing, but its also a relief for me. We'll figure this out. Hang in there!

Hi Erica! I was sleeved 6/2 and I can still only take 3 - 4 bites. What's so hard for me is every one on this site has a different progression of food. What has been wonderful for me is Greek yogurt & Tilapia. Pasta goes down well if I only have 3 bites. Also, a suggestion from a 2 yr vet of the sleeve said to set an alarm. 7 - Breakfast, 10 - shake, 12:30 - lunch, 3 - shake, and 6:30 dinner. I still don't hit all of that every day, but it has helped with "normalcy". OH - AND CONGRATULATIONS ON 20 LBS!!! That's fantastic!
